Václav Dostál is a scholar working on Mechanical Engineering, Aerospace Engineering and Biomedical Engineering. According to data from OpenAlex, Václav Dostál has authored 37 papers receiving a total of 1.2k ind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Mechanical Engineering, 12 papers in Aerospace Engineering and 9 papers in Biomedical Engineering. Recurrent topics in Václav Dostál's work include Nuclear reactor physics and engineering (7 papers), Carbon Dioxide Capture Technologies (5 papers) and Parkinson's Disease Mechanisms and Treatments (5 papers). Václav Dostál is often cited by papers focused on Nuclear reactor physics and engineering (7 papers), Carbon Dioxide Capture Technologies (5 papers) and Parkinson's Disease Mechanisms and Treatments (5 papers). Václav Dostál collaborates with scholars based in Czechia, Japan and United States. Václav Dostál's co-authors include Pavel Hejzlar, Michael J. Driscoll, N.E. Todreas, Irena Rektorová, Martin Bareš, Jana Velı́šková, Minoru Takahashi, Ivan Rektor, Karel Urbánek and Edvard Ehler and has published in prestigious journals such as SHILAP Revista de lepidopterología, European Journal of Neurology and Progress in Nuclear Energy.
